Description & Specifications

The updated and versatile, low profile, heavy duty, fire-rated solution

The 4500 series is the first electric strike designed for installation in 2" UL 10C fire-rated frames with ½" drywall penetration. The 4500 electric strike features a low profile 1-3/8" depth, heavy-duty cast stainless steel construction and two interchangeable faceplates designed to accommodate a variety of locksets for simple installation. Its strength is derived from a unique keeper pin locking design, enabling the 4500 to exceed the ratings of the frame, door and locking hardware. Designed for use with cylindrical and mortise locksets up to a 3/4" throw.

Specifications

  • UL 10C fire rated, 3 hour (fail secure only)
  • CAN4-S104 (ULC-S104) fire door conformant
  • WHI fire door listed
  • UL 1034 burglary resistant listed
  • ANSI/BHMA A156.31, Grade 1 (#E09321, #E09322, #E09323)
  • NFPA-252 fire door conformant
  • ASTM-E152 fire door conformant
  • California Fire Marshall Listed
  • UBC-7-2-94, Uniform Building Code
  • Patent #5,934,720

 

Frame application

  • Metal
  • Wood

 

Electrical

  • .24 Amps @ 12VDC/VAC
  • .12 Amps @ 24VDC/VAC
  • DC continuous duty/AC intermittent duty only

 

Standard Features

  • Stainless steel construction
  • Tamper resistant
  • Static strength 3,000 lbs.
  • Dynamic strength 100 ft-lbs.
  • Endurance 1,000,000 cycles
  • Field selectable fail safe/fail secure
  • Dual voltage 12 or 24 VAC/VDC
  • Two faceplates provided to accommodate a variety of locksets
  • Non-handed
  • Internally mounted solenoid
  • Accommodates up to a 3/4" latchbolt
  • Strike body depth 1-3/8"
  • Plug-in connector
  • Trim enhancer
  • Full keeper shims for horizontal adjustment

 

Optional Features

  • LBM - Latchbolt monitor
  • LBSM - Latchbolt strike monitor

 

Note: Relocation of the strike prep may be required for Schlage L Series and Yale 8700 mortise locks.
